Software setup

Setting up Door Tablet to use with your sensors is easy. The following is required:
  1. On the system profile, tell Door Tablet you will be using motion sensors
  2. For each room insert the IP address and the UID you got when setting up the sensors

Note: You can test connectivity with sensors on your Door Tablet Apps, even without any server set-up.

App settings
If you have set-up a meeting space as shown above there is nothing else for you to do. Just open the meeting space. If you wish to either test a sensor or the space is not set-up, you can add settings on the local app, which will override the data from the server. You may also disable sensing in a space if a sensor is not installed but the database indicates there is one. You may also use this feature if more than one display is attached to a meeting space. For example, when using pairs in out-of-meeting spaces and in-meeting space configuration.

Settings you added to the database will show on the app:





Local Settings

Apart from enabling the sensor, you do not have to make changes in local settings unless you would like to test the connection. Fill in the IP address and Unit ID. If you changed the default port used for the connection (4280), add your special port number to end of the IP address, in the standard way, for example 192.168.1.160:666.

If "Disable Sensor" is ticked, which is the default, un-tick it.



Example Tests





Testing a Crestron Occupancy sensor

The process is near identical to the one above but instead of specifying an IP address, just type "crestron" in the field. Please note that Crestron sensors will only work when using Crestron displays. If you use other hardware, like the Door Tablet AIO/SL/TC/CIR you must use a Door Table SEN device.
